    Position Summary:

    Set up, operate and tend machines to saw, cut, shear, slit, punch, crimp, notch, bend or straighten metal.

    Essential Functions:

    • Perform typical press operations, adhering to quality assurance procedures and processes.
    • Start machines, monitor operations, and record operational data.
    • Measure completed work pieces to verify conformance to specifications, using micrometers, gauges, calipers, templates, or rulers.
    • Examine completed work pieces for defects, such as chipped edges or marred surfaces and sort defective pieces according to types of flaws.
    • Detect and report defective materials or questionable conditions to department supervisor.
    • Perform prescribed preventative maintenance on machines as required. Clean and lubricate machines.
    • Maintain work area and equipment in clean and orderly condition and follow prescribed safety regulations.
